• AnMBR technology for municipal wastewater treatment is critically reviewed.
• AnMBRs can be of vital importance when use of treated effluent is considered.
• Treatment performance of AnMBRs is dependent on the chosen process configuration.
• Membrane coupled UASB reactors are promising for municipal wastewater treatment.
• Alternative integration possibilities for AnMBR are of interest to further develop.
In recent years, anaerobic membrane bioreactor technology for municipal wastewater treatment is increasingly being researched as a cost-effective alternative to produce nutrient rich, solids free effluents with a high degree of pathogen removal, while occupying a small footprint. To date, especially in the last decade, many studies have been conducted in which various types of anaerobic reactors were used in combination with membranes. This review critically evaluates the potential of anaerobic membrane bioreactor technology for municipal wastewater treatment with a focus on different types of anaerobic reactors that membranes are coupled to. In addition, the paper discusses the impact of the various factors on both biological and filtration performances of anaerobic membrane bioreactors including strengths and limitations.
